Abstract :

Ovarian cancer is the most lethal of the gynecologic malignancies, exploring the related molecular mechanisms of initiation and development, and identifying possible targets for the treatment of ovarian carcinoma has taken into insight nowadays. Ras homolog gene family member C (RhoC) is a small G protein/guanosine triphosphatase involved in tumor mobility, invasion, and metastasis. Our previous studies showed that RhoC expression was positively correlated to ovarian carcinogenesis, clinical stage and vascularization in ovarian cancer. RhoC inhibitor, Lovastatin, could inhibit ovarian cancer cell proliferation, migration and invasion through downregulating RhoC and modulating relevant gene expression. Besides, we also found a series of microRNAs and LncRNAs which play important roles in ovarian carcinoma pathological processes through regulating RhoC directly or indirectly. Above all, we suggest that the up-regulated RhoC expression may affect ovarian carcinogenesis and should be considered as a good biomarker and also a potential therapeutic target for the treatment of ovarian carcinoma.
